Conquering Cryptography: The Power of Brute Force

In the relentless digital arena, where data reigns supreme, a formidable weapon emerges: brute-force attacks. These cryptographic assults exploit sheer computational power to decipher encrypted messages and unlock sensitive information. Like ancient siege engines relentlessly hammering against castle walls, brute-force algorithms grind through every possible combination of characters until the true solution presents itself. While often associated with exposed systems, brute-force attacks can be surprisingly effective against basic cryptographic schemes, highlighting the importance of robust security measures.

  • Nonetheless, the effectiveness of brute force is directly proportional to the complexity of the target encryption.
  • For a result, sophisticated algorithms employing large key lengths render brute-force attacks computationally infeasible within any reasonable timeframe.

The rise of quantum computing poses an intriguing challenge to current cryptographic defenses. These revolutionary machines possess the potential to exponentially accelerate brute-force computations, threatening the security of widely used encryption protocols. Consequently, the digital experts is actively exploring new approaches to develop post-quantum cryptography, resilient against the looming threat of quantum-enhanced brute force.
